Our Verdict - Egyptian Angel EDP
A divisive clone lacking punch, Egyptian Angel is often seen as a shadow of its inspiration. While some laud its lasting power over the original, others find it a weak, linear cedar-bomb that misses key notes entirely. Don't expect a crowd-pleaser.

Our Verdict - Straight to Heaven Extreme EDP
This one's a divisive beast, a boozy, woody ride that some call a masterpiece and others just won't get on with. Expect a deep, seductive aroma that projects confidence and refinement. It won't be for everyone, but if it clicks for you, prepare for an intoxicating experience.

Occasions

Best For:
Office Casual
Also Works:
Date

Its generally weak projection makes it suitable for office wear without offending, though some report good longevity. The woody, warm accords are versatile for casual settings, but its lack of strong sillage limits its impact for formal events or a big night out.

Occasions

Best For:
Date Formal
Also Works:
Casual

With strong projection and long-lasting performance, this scent is too bold for a typical office environment. Reviews repeatedly highlight its masculinity and sexiness, making it ideal for dates and special formal events, especially in cooler weather.
